Toffee Apple Dip Recipe
Introduction
This Toffee Apple Dip is a delightful and creamy treat perfect for fall or any time you want a sweet and tangy snack. The combination of cream cheese, brown sugar, cinnamon, and crunchy toffee bits pairs beautifully with crisp apple slices. It’s easy to make and sure to impress your guests.

Ingredients
- 1 8-ounce package of cream cheese (room temperature)
- ⅔ cup packed light brown sugar
- ¼ teaspoon ground cinnamon
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 8-ounce package Heath English Toffee Bits (Bits O’ Brickle – the one without the milk chocolate)
- 3-4 medium tart apples (sliced)
Instructions
- Step 1: In a medium mixing bowl, beat the cream cheese with an electric hand mixer on medium speed for 2-3 minutes until smooth and creamy.
- Step 2: Add the brown sugar, cinnamon, and vanilla extract to the cream cheese. Continue beating on medium speed for an additional 3 minutes until well combined.
- Step 3: Using a rubber spatula, gently fold in the toffee bits until fully incorporated throughout the dip.
- Step 4: Cover the bowl and refrigerate the dip for at least 3 hours to allow the flavors to meld and the dip to firm up.
- Step 5: Serve chilled with sliced tart apples for dipping. Enjoy!
Tips & Variations
- Use Granny Smith or other tart apples to balance the sweetness of the dip.
- For a nuttier flavor, sprinkle chopped toasted pecans on top before serving.
- If you prefer a smoother dip, grind the toffee bits slightly before folding them in.
- Substitute the toffee bits with chopped caramel candies for a different twist.
Storage
Store the dip covered in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days. Stir gently before serving if it thickens. The apple slices are best served fresh; keep any cut apples in an airtight container with a little lemon juice to prevent browning.

FAQs
Can I make this dip ahead of time?
Yes, this dip actually tastes better after refrigerating for a few hours or overnight, which allows the flavors to develop fully.
What can I use if I don’t have toffee bits?
You can substitute toffee bits with chopped caramel candies, crushed toffee bars, or even chopped nuts for added texture and sweetness.
